"Notebooks" are posthumously published notebooks by Ivo Andrić, consisting of twelve original volumes and separate sheets. They contain his thoughts on literature, history, art, man, and the creative process.

The thirteenth volume of the first edition of Matoš's collected works brings together dramatic attempts and theater and concert criticism from the period 1897–1909, revealing Matoš as an insightful theater critic.

Zuka Džumhur's Pilgrimage is a blend of travelogue, essay, and cultural chronicle: a book about cities, people, and history, written humorously, eruditely, and with a distinct sense of the atmosphere of a place.
